In Episode 62 of the Investing in Impact podcast, Causeartist contributor, Rafael Aldon, speaks with Jessica Burley, Investor at Planet A Ventures, on investing in early-stage startups that are developing climate change solutions.

Jessica Burley is an investor at Planet A Ventures, a venture capital firm that invests in climate tech startups. She holds a Politics degree from Cambridge University and has a background in climate finance and sustainable development.

Prior to joining Planet A, she worked as an analyst at a climate VC firm and as a researcher for the United Nations.

What is Planet A Ventures?

Planet A Ventures is a venture capital firm that invests in climate tech startups. The firm was founded in 2022 and has raised €160 million for its first fund, which it plans to invest in early-stage startups that are developing solutions to climate change.

Planet A’s Investment Thesis

Planet A invests in climate tech startups that are working to decarbonize the economy. The firm’s investment thesis is based on the following pillars:

  • Science-based targets: Planet A only invests in startups that have set ambitious science-based targets to reduce their emissions.
  • Impact: Planet A measures the impact of its investments on the environment.
  • Diversity: Planet A is committed to investing in a diverse set of startups, including those founded by women and people of color.

Planet A Ventures’ Core Principles

Planet A Ventures' Core Principles
  • Tomorrow’s economy is based on today’s investment decisions. Venture capital has the power to accelerate the transformation to a sustainable future. Planet A Ventures was founded on this belief.

    The firm exists to support bold and brave founders who are driving the green transformation. When Planet A’s founders profit, the planet profits too.
  • Make scientific impact investing the new normal. Planet A Ventures’ scientists and entrepreneurs collaborate closely to assess the ecological innovation potential of a startup.

    The firm strives to make this science-meets-business approach a standard in venture capital. Planet A Ventures does not just acknowledge the environmental impact of economic decisions, but makes it the compass guiding those decisions.

    That is why the firm openly shares its methods and results to inspire and support others to adopt a scientific approach.
  • Investing is just the start. Through its operational platform and extensive network, Planet A Ventures helps and mentors founders to develop their companies, with impact as the central metric of success.

    The Planet A Platform is a source of expertise for founders and their teams, providing access to successful entrepreneurs, proven scientific experts, and impact-driven investors.

Some of the Companies in Planet A’s Portfolio

Some of the companies in Planet A’s portfolio include:

  • Carbon Re: Carbon Re is a company that uses artificial intelligence to remove carbon dioxide from the atmosphere.
  • Makersite: Makersite is a company that helps companies manage their product supply chains in a sustainable way.
  • one.five: one.five is a company that makes circular biomaterials that can replace single-use plastics.
